1. Disassociate from Your Home

It can be hard to let go of your home. You have lived there, sometimes for years, and the house likely holds many memories. When you are ready to sell, you must emotionally detach from it. Looking to the future is a good way to do this.

2. Depersonalize the House

Now is the time to pack away all your family heirlooms, personal photographs, and other clutter and objects that may distract a potential buyer and hurt the possibility of making a sale. It is important to present buyers with a clean and impersonal environment so they can imagine their own things in the space.

When you depersonalize the home, it makes it easier for potential buyers to visualize how the space may look once they have moved in. With furniture, make sure you only leave understated pieces that are not distracting, and that do not create a bad impression.

3. Get Rid of Clutter

If you are like most people, you have likely accumulated many items over the years. You may hang on to all these things because of an emotional attachment, the intention to use them or fix the items eventually, or because you want to pass them down. However, for some items, if you have not used them for a year or more, there is a good chance there is no reason to keep them.

Make sure to get rid of items that you no longer need. You can donate the items to a nonprofit organization or charity. When you do this, you can feel confident that the items you no longer want or need are used by someone, and there are some that are tax-deductible.

You should also remove any knick-knacks around your house and take books off the bookcase. Clean everything off the counters in the kitchen, too. If there are essential items that you find each day, you can tuck them away in boxes and put the boxes in closets when the items are not being used. This is also a great way to begin packing.

4. Organize Storage Cabinets and Bedroom Closets

Most buyers are going to be interested in the storage space in your home. As a result, you need to make sure your cabinets and closets are clean and organized. If you have storage areas that are full and cluttered, it will be a turn off for buyers.

When a potential buyer sees that everything has been carefully organized, it shows you care about the house. Be sure to put time into organizing the cabinets, drawers, and closets throughout your home.

home staged for sale

5. Think About Renting a Storage Space

Virtually every home is going to make a better impression with less furniture. Take time to remove any items that are blocking or hindering walkways or paths. Put these things in storage, along with any empty bookcases or distracting artwork. Leave enough furniture to showcase the purpose of the room.
